Great alarm, design and build quality. Good value payed £169 at homebase. possible problem is fitting. do not beleive the jokers in these reviews who fitted it in 3 hours. Took me most of the weekend to fit one for my daughter. Problem is complex programming easy to get lost. Also time depends on availability of power and phone lines to feed the control panel. You need a good set of ladders plus cord less drill for fitting siren 20 foot from floor. Pity the Yale help line is not open weekends also they do not beleive in slotted holes which would make drilling in masonary easier. Be care ful with the siren best to wear ear defenders when dealing with it. Overall a super product The optional extre key fob made it a dream to use for my daughter . Great wotk Yale.
